## Build Provenance: Checkout Load Tests

Quick rule for the Pennybright checkout flow: every load-test run must point at a provenance-stamped build, not whatever's on staging. The Hammerline harness refuses unsigned artifacts anyway. Pull the artifact, verify the attestation, then fire away. The run record needs the build token pasted right here.

build token for haduf-bafog: htk21_2d98ce91a83676b65394a

Runbook: account recovery — telemetry compression. Plugin authors: during recovery flows, Fernwick compresses telemetry payloads with zstd level 3 before dispatch. Do not double-compress; the gateway rejects nested archives. Verify your plugin's manifest declares the codec. To test against the recovery sandbox, supply the shared passphrase, which is:

vault phrase of yahif-hahaf = istael-gorir-fenwyn-belael-novys-novok-juldor

This page documents the three PayStream environments (dev, staging, prod-mirror) with particular attention to the flaky integration tests that have plagued staging since the Fennick gateway upgrade. The flakiness correlates with staging's shorter settlement-simulation window and an undersized sandbox ledger, so failures there do not necessarily block a release. Prod-mirror is the authoritative environment for go/no-go decisions; dev is best-effort only. For reference during release review, the staging configuration values are listed below.

service settings:
[casax]
port = 6379
team = rusir
host = casax.zemvarhq.corp
region = outer-4
access_code = ac_9808ce
timeout_ms = 1500